Profile Summary

About Howard Grun at a glance

Howard Grun is a Member based in New York, New York, practicing at Kaufman Friedman Plotnicki & Grun, LLP. They have 41+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1985. Their practice focuses on business, real estate, estate litigation, litigation, and appellate. Admitted to practice in New York (1985), U.S. District Court, Southern District of New York (1991), U.S. District Court, Eastern District of New York (1991), and U.S. Court of Appeals, Second Circuit (1993). Educated at Temple University (J.D., 1984) and New York University (B.S., 1981). Active member of The Association of the Bar of the City of New York (Member, Housing Court Committee, 1995-1997) American Bar Association.
